Yo-yo dieting is more common than people think. People who fall victim to yo-yo dieting lose the weight only to gain it all back again. This is, in part, due to dieting methods that include skipping meals, cutting calories too drastically, taking weight off too quickly, as well as other pitfalls of dieting. There are dangers in losing and then regaining substantial amounts of weight loss. It is noted by researchers who have studied this topic that the death rate among yo-yo dieters is higher and they put themselves at a greater risk for other health problems. In your attempts to lose weight do not concentrate or associate your eating with dieting, but instead make a change in your eating habits themselves and concentrate on lowering your portions of food. Eat healthy foods and exercise, limit your food intake, drink more water and try to keep caffeine intake at a minimum. Keep up your exercise regime at least three times weekly.
